Transaction 75f24ad0b1b3a4bf3c6798dd35e01c23835d872e333253e2fe3ef287e1a1448a
1 Input
1 Output
-
75f24ad0b1b3a4bf3c6798dd35e01c23835d872e333253e2fe3ef287e1a1448a:0
- value
- 96136316
- script pubkey
- OP_0 OP_PUSHBYTES_20 2519a77ff35e59057a91eb4c89e4ad2a492c421a
- address
- bc1qy5v6wllntevs2753adxgne9d9fyjcss6atfxrq